Examination Review for Ultrasound: SPI – Sonographic Principles & Instrumentation, 2nd Edition by Steven M. Penny and Traci B. Fox (ISBN 9781496377326)
Examination Review for Ultrasound: SPI – Sonographic Principles & Instrumentation, 2nd Edition by Steven M. Penny and Traci B. Fox provides a concise and complete review of the physics principles needed to pass the ARDMS Sonographic Principles and Instrumentation (SPI) exam. Published by Lippincott Williams & Wilkins, this updated edition delivers crystal-clear explanations, practice questions, and diagrams that make complex concepts easy to master.

This easy-to-use study resource simplifies ultrasound physics into digestible sections with colorful illustrations, clinical examples, and hundreds of practice questions. Each chapter builds understanding of the fundamental concepts required for certification, focusing on practical application and test-taking strategies.
Key Features of the 2nd Edition
- Comprehensive SPI Exam Coverage: Includes all ARDMS Sonographic Principles & Instrumentation topics.
- Updated Content: Reflects the latest ARDMS test blueprint and recent technology updates.
- 500+ Practice Questions: With detailed rationales and image-based answers.
- High-Yield Summaries: Concise concept reviews, formulas, and quick reference charts.
- Visual Learning Design: Color diagrams and illustrations enhance retention of key physics principles.
- Exam Strategies: Step-by-step methods for solving calculation and concept-based questions.
Table of Contents Highlights
- Fundamentals of Sound and Wave Propagation
- Pulse-Echo Principles and Image Formation
- Transducers and Beam Characteristics
- Doppler and Hemodynamics
- Resolution, Artifacts, and Image Quality
- Instrumentation, Display, and Post-Processing
- Bioeffects, Safety, and Quality Assurance
- Mock SPI Practice Exam and Rationales
